Transaction 6dea9ec7815eb66e52459366267acfdf175f59cd4798aef87dbded636aa45879
1 Input
1 Output
-
6dea9ec7815eb66e52459366267acfdf175f59cd4798aef87dbded636aa45879:0
- value
- 358894
- script pubkey
- OP_0 OP_PUSHBYTES_20 38c39d550fe9c1ebb43bceeb740bd479165cacdf
- address
- bc1q8rpe64g0a8q7hdpmem4hgz750yt9etxl4eh9vm